News You Me At Six detail new album ‘Truth Decay’

They’re also sharing new track ‘Mixed Emotions (I Didn’t Know How To Tell You What I Was Going Through)’.

Set for release on 27th January via Underdog Records / AWAL Recordings, You Me At Six have shared the details for their upcoming new album ‘Truth Decay’.

“The album generally is the band doing all the things that we as a band think we’re good at and just embellishing them and finessing those ideas and just trying to do retrospective, quintessential YMAS but in 2022 and give that a new lease of life,” Josh Franceschi says. “For us we saw people around us, our peers and some new blood coming through that were doing emo rock music again and we thought ‘well we know how to do that and we want the world to know how we do it’.”
